TBN_GETBUTTONINFO notification code

Retrieves toolbar customization information and notifies the toolbar's parent window of any changes being made to the toolbar. This notification code is sent in the form of a WM_NOTIFY message.

TBN_GETBUTTONINFO 

    lpnmtb = (LPNMTOOLBAR) lParam; 

Parameters

lParam

Pointer to an NMTOOLBAR structure. The iItem member specifies a zero-based index that provides a count of the buttons the Customize Toolbar dialog box displays as both available and present on the toolbar. The pszText member specifies the address of the current button text, and cchText specifies its length in characters. The application should fill the structure with information about the button.

Return value

Returns TRUE if button information was copied to the specified structure, or FALSE otherwise.

Remarks

The toolbar control allocates a buffer, and the receiver (parent window) must copy the text into that buffer. The cchText member contains the length of the buffer allocated by the toolbar when TBN_GETBUTTONINFO is sent to the parent window.

Requirements

Requirement Value
Minimum supported client
Windows Vista [desktop apps only]
Minimum supported server
Windows Server 2003 [desktop apps only]
Header
Commctrl.h
Unicode and ANSI names
TBN_GETBUTTONINFOW (Unicode) and TBN_GETBUTTONINFOA (ANSI)